Tuesday, August 14, 1979 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Afghanistan on Tuesday, August 14, 1979 at 14:24 UTC with a magnitude of 5.1. The closest known location in the current dataset is Fayzabad (Afghanistan - AF), about 73.0 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 70.903 and latitude 36.514.
